Abstract

The utility model discloses a kind of more fold films, belong to film applications, including base and the protective layer that the base two sides are arranged in, the two sides of the base have protrusion, a groove is formed between the two neighboring protrusion, the spreading width that the protective layer corresponds to the width position of the groove is greater than the width of the groove, utility model has the advantages that passing through setting groove, film is in bending, due to mechanical characteristic, it can preferentially be bent in weak load-bearing point when bending, the position of protective layer respective protrusions can't generate extension when therefore bending, and the part of respective slot width position can generate extension, but since the spreading width of this position is larger, therefore it largely can reduce the deformation of protective layer, extend the service life of film.

Background technique
Film is a kind of thin and flexible transparent sheet.It is made of plastics, adhesive, rubber or other materials.Membrane science On explanation are as follows: by atom, 2 dimension materials that molecule or ion deposition are formed in substrate surface.Example: optical thin film, laminated film, Superconducting thin film, polyester film, nylon film, plastic film etc..Film is widely used in electronic apparatus, mechanical, the row such as printing Industry.
Plastic film is usually used thin made of polyvinyl chloride, polyethylene, polypropylene, polystyrene and other resins Film for packing, and is used as coating layer.Shared share is increasing on the market for plastics package and plastic packet product, Especially composite plastic flexible package has been widely used for the fields such as food, medicine, chemical industry, wherein again with food packaging institute Accounting example is maximum, such as beverage packaging, quick-frozen food packaging, cooking food packaging, fast food packaging etc., these products are all given People's life brings great convenience.
However some films are chronically exposed to outdoor, plasticizer is gradually oozed out to surface, and plasticizer is in use not Disconnected volatilization, rain and dew can make plasticizer fade away the extraction of plasticizer in addition.Plasticizer is industrially to be widely used High molecular material auxiliary agent, this substance is added in plastic processing, can make its flexibility enhance, be easily worked, plasticizer Evolution rear film, which can be hardened, to become fragile, and aging of turning to be yellow, the ultraviolet light long-term irradiation in sunlight will lead to plasticizer and go bad, and can also cause Film aging.
In addition, traditional film is lamination layer structure, in bending, according to material deformation principle, one side material Extruding, opposite side generation extension are generated, and neutral line does not generate variation, therefore film is in the process for bending and extending repeatedly In be easy to produce embrittlement, most film when in use, such as greenhouse film, can generate bending and extension when being laid with, newly Film when in use since toughness and ductility are preferable, be generally not in problem.But since film needs to recycle, And need often film to be raised and covered conjunction in different plantation periods, it inevitably can more frequently be produced during aforesaid operations Raw bending and extension, when using the time, too long, when film is hardened, ductility and toughness decline, traditional film is due to frequent Generation material extruding and extend can accelerated ageing embrittlement process, reduce the service life.

Specific embodiment
It is described below for disclosing the utility model so that those skilled in the art can be realized the utility model.It retouches below Preferred embodiment in stating is only used as illustrating, it may occur to persons skilled in the art that other obvious modifications.
As shown in Figs. 1-2, one embodiment of the utility model: a kind of more fold films, including base 10 and setting exist The protective layer of 10 two sides of base, the two sides of the base 10 have to be formed between protrusion 11, two neighboring described raised 11 One groove, the spreading width that the protective layer corresponds to the width position of the groove is greater than the width of the groove, such as Fig. 1 institute Showing, the width of groove is the distance between a point and b point H, and protective layer generates the extension 21 of indent in the corresponding position distance H, Width i.e. under its flat is greater than H.
The protective layer includes the anti-evolution layer 20 and anti-aging layer 22 set gradually from inside to outside, and anti-evolution layer 20 can be with The evolution speed for reducing plasticiser 30, reduces the brittle speed of film.
The anti-evolution layer 20 is made of EVOH material, and EVOH has preferable insulating effect, can reduce plasticiser 30 Evolution speed, and the EVOH transparency with higher, can reduce anti-evolution layer 20 influences lighting effect.EVOH (ethylene/ Ethenol copolymer, Ethylene vinyl alcohol copolymer) it is always to apply most high barrier materials.This The film type of kind material is other than non-stretching type, and there are also biaxial tension type, aluminium-vapour deposition type, binder application type etc., two-way drawings It stretches in type and is used for aseptic packaging product there are also heat resistant type.EVOH distinguishing feature is that have fabulous barrier property and fabulous to gas Processability, otherwise see-through property, glossiness, mechanical strength, retractility, wearability, cold resistance and surface strength are all very excellent.Increase Volatilization can gradually be escaped outward by moulding agent, and the anti-spilled layer made of EVOH has good insulating effect, can slow down plasticising The evolution of agent extends the service life of film.
The anti-aging layer 22 is made of the PVC material for being embedded with ultraviolet radiation absorption particle, and ultraviolet radiation absorption particle can be with The ultraviolet light in sunlight is absorbed, the rate of deterioration of plasticiser 30 is reduced.Ultraviolet radiation absorption particle is a kind of light stabilizer, can be absorbed Ultraviolet part in sunlight and fluorescent light source, and itself does not change.Due to containing in sunray largely to coloured The harmful ultraviolet light of object, about 290-460 nanometers of wavelength, these harmful ultraviolet lights pass through redox chemically (Redox reaction), makes color molecule finally decompose colour fading.It is embedded in ultraviolet resistant layer into ultraviolet radiation absorption particle, it can By the ultraviolet radiation absorption in sunlight, to reduce its rotten catalysis to the plasticizer in base 10.
Plasticiser 30 is provided in the groove, the two sides of the film are blocked by the protective layer, are arranged in groove Plasticiser 30 base 10 and protective layer can be made to keep toughness, delaying aging speed for a long time with slow release.
It is arc transition between described raised 11 and the base 10, by mechanical characteristic it is found that material is in bending, by Power centrostigma is to most easily produce breaking part, and asking for stress centrostigma is not present due to being open and flat setting in conventional films Topic, and since there are the design of groove, the transition position of protrusion 11 and base 10 will form stress centrostigma in the application, therefore will Circular arc chamfering 12 is designed as between protrusion 11 and base 10 to avoid transition position from generating disconnected to avoid the formation of stress centrostigma It splits.
Compared with the prior art, the advantages of the utility model are: film is in bending, due to power by setting groove Learn characteristic, when bending, can preferentially be bent in weak load-bearing point, therefore when bending protective layer respective protrusions 11 position not Extension can be generated, and the part of respective slot width position can generate extension, but since the spreading width of this position is larger, because This largely can reduce the deformation of protective layer, extend the service life of film.
